What will the weather in Roundstone be like during my visit?
The warmest months in Roundstone are usually July and August with an average temp of 54°F. January and February are the chilliest months when the average temp is 41°F. The rainiest months are December and November.

Things to do in Roundstone for first time

Roundstone, a charming fishing village, offers a perfect three-day getaway to explore stunning beaches, majestic mountains, and lush natural parks. Enjoy outdoor activities like hiking, boating, and sea diving, while immersing yourself in the local art scene. This gem is a haven for n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. Here's a quick itinerary to make the most of your trip to Roundstone:

  • Day 1: Begin your exploration at Connemara National Park, where you can enjoy stunning landscapes, hiking trails, and the breathtaking beauty of the Twelve Bens mountain range. After immersing yourself in nature, head to Dan O'Hara's Connemara Heritage and History Centre to learn about the rich cultural heritage of this region through engaging exhibits and demonstrations. Finally, conclude your day at the picturesque Kylemore Abbey, a stunning Victorian castle set against a backdrop of lush gardens and serene lakes, offering insight into its fascinating history and breathtaking views.
  • Day 2: Start your adventure with a scenic drive along the Sky Road, where panoramic views of the Atlantic Ocean and Connemara's rugged coastline await. After soaking in the vistas, visit the Alcock and Brown Landing Site, a historical landmark commemorating the first transatlantic flight. Wrap up your day at Mannin Bay Beach, where you can relax on the sandy shores, enjoy a leisurely walk, or take in the sunset over the water, making for a perfect end to your day.
  • Day 3: Kick off your day at Clifden Castle, where you can explore the ruins and enjoy the views of the surrounding countryside. Next, head to the Marconi Trans Atlantic Wireless Station, a site of significant historical importance, where you can learn about the early days of wireless communication. Finally, unwind at Black Pool, a local beach known for its stunning views and serene atmosphere, perfect for a refreshing stroll or simply soaking up the natural beauty of the area.

Best time to go to Roundstone

Roundstone exper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 40.3°F (4.6°C), while July and August are the hottest months, with an average temperature of 55.4°F (13.0°C). December is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Roundstone, June to August are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, October to December are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
